Overview
Shawn Levy (born July 23, 1968) is a Canadian director, producer and occasional actor who has worked across mainstream studio features and television. He is best known for lighthearted comedies, family-friendly adventure films and for producing and directing projects for streaming platforms. Levy combines broad commercial sensibilities with a focus on storytelling that appeals to family and general audiences. His career includes directing studio comedies, effects-driven family adventures and serving as a producer on high-profile television series.

3 ImagesCareer highlights and notable works
Levy's filmography includes several commercially successful studio pictures. Selected directing credits include:
- Big Fat Liar (2002)
- Just Married (2003)
- Cheaper by the Dozen (2003)
- The Pink Panther (2006)
- Night at the Museum (2006) and its sequels
- Date Night (2010), Real Steel (2011)
- The Internship (2013)
- This Is Where I Leave You (2014)
In recent years Levy has also directed and produced projects for streaming platforms and studio tentpoles. He has expanded into producing films that blend spectacle with comedic beats and has overseen development for both big-budget features and smaller ensemble pieces.
Television work and production
Before his feature work became prominent, Levy built experience directing episodic television. Early television directing credits included family and teen series such as The Secret World of Alex Mack and The Famous Jett Jackson. He later became closely associated with Netflix and other streamers as a producer and executive producer. Most notably he has been involved with the hit series Stranger Things, where his company served in a producing capacity while he helped shepherd the show during its early development.

Background and personal life
Shawn Levy was born and raised in Montreal, Canada, in the province of Quebec. He has been married and is a parent; his family life has been mentioned in profiles of his career. Levy is of Jewish heritage and has spoken about how his background intersects with his life and work. Style, reception and legacy
Levy's films are frequently described as crowd-pleasing and broadly accessible, mixing situational comedy, heart and visual invention. While critical responses have varied across his titles, his films have often found strong box office returns and durable popularity with family audiences. His role as a producer on successful television series and his work building projects for streaming services have made him a recognizable figure in contemporary North American entertainment production.
